Getting to know Roslynn Scott-Adams

Greetings, I am a licensed social worker with 32 years of experience. I absolutely love helping others and have worked in mental health for 30 years. I earned my Master’s in Social Work from Howard University and my PhD in Social Work from The Catholic University of America in 2007. I aim to provide a safe and non-judgmental space for everyone I work with to resolve the issues that are most challenging to them.

More information on payments and coverage

Payment is due after each session and will be charged with your card on file for any portion of patient responsibility. Receipts will be provided at the time of the charge. This typically takes place 2-4 weeks after the session, once your insurance has had a chance to process the claim. We try our best to verify eligibility, but it is ultimately your responsibility to check coverage and out-of-pocket costs for services. For out-of-network visits, you will be billed at the provider’s self-pay rate, and we can provide an invoice for you to submit to your insurance for potential out-of-network reimbursement based on your plan’s benefits.
